    '96 Bridgeport

    Just an off topic question. I was watching the 1996 Bridgeport Highlight tape the other day and me and my brother were wondering how many yards Widmor ran for that year. If anyone knows, feel free to chime in.

      It was over 2000...like 2400...he scored 37 or 38 tds and he averaged close to if not more than 9ypc.....and we didn't play the 4th quarter in 6 of the games....also Bodor had over 1000...Widmor had 1950ish his junior year too, and would have gotten 2000, but got hurt against Madonna in week 10 and missed the 2nd half...
